"Swingin' Live At The Church In Tulsa" by Taj Mahal Sextet is not just an album; it's an electrifying experience captured in the hallowed acoustics of a historic Tulsa church, where music transcends its surroundings and takes on a life of its own. Recorded live, this album showcases Taj Mahal and his ensemble pouring their soulful artistry into every note, blending elements of blues, jazz, and world music with a spontaneity that only a live setting can inspire. The richness of the church's ambient sound elevates the performance, turning each track into a visceral celebration that transports listeners to the heart of a vibrant concert. From the sway of the rhythms to the soulful interludes, the album invites you to revel in the communal joy of live music.

Notes:
"Splattered Tri-Color" variant limited to 500 copies. 100 copies were autographed by Taj and sold directly on his Bandcamp.
Legendary roots star Taj Mahal announced the release of Swingin’ Live at the Church in Tulsa, released on March 8 2024 via Lightning Rod records. His latest project is an extraordinary set recorded live at the Tulsa studio best known as the home base of the late, great Leon Russell, a huge influence and personal friend of Taj. The ten songs reach across multiple genres that he has explored in his incomparable career, and feature “The Taj Mahal Sextet,” which includes Taj’s long-time quartet—bassist Bill Rich, drummer Kester Smith, and guitarist/Hawaiian lap steel player Bobby Ingano—augmented by dobro player Rob Ickes and guitarist and vocalist Trey Hensley.
